Kitchen Light Installation

Today the main kitchen light fixture was installed. The electrician and the contractor worked together to lift and suspend the unit. The unit has a combination of high output fluorescent tubes and low voltage incandescent lighting which are separately switched.....the low voltage lights are controlled by a dimmer switch. Tomorrow the clear wiring chords of the unit as well as the dropped pendant light will be finished anchored to the beams above.
